In order to do something to make my Pulstek OpticBook 3800 scanner work with 
sane I'd like to offer sane developers a remote access to my dev-desktop with 
scanner attach to it and with webcam+sound video streaming showing this 
scanner.

If you send me ssh public key and login, I will grant you root access there 
and tell where to watch webcam streaming.


Just for note:
I've already reported about Pulstek OpticBook 3800
http://lists.alioth.debian.org/pipermail/sane-devel/2013-April/031220.html
USB sniff etc. We found out that it uses GL845, basic GL845 support were added 
to sane after that, but it did not make it work properly. It do not even move 
carriage as it should but makes unpleasant sounds instead.


A year ago 3800 was the only economy class device allowing scanning books 
without opening them wide. I think it is important to have this device 
supported by linux. There is no alternatives for it thus I can't just simply 
replace it.
